2. Description of the Service
Gazebo is an identity and access management (IAM) platform for AI agents. It allows you to store credentials for third-party services in an encrypted vault, issue AI agents scoped access to specific services, review and approve AI-generated configuration workflows before they execute, and audit every credential access and API call made on your behalf. Access is available via the web application, a REST API, and an MCP endpoint for direct agent integration.

5. Your connected services, credentials, and agents
By connecting a third-party service (e.g. storing a Stripe API key in the vault), you authorise Gazebo to store that credential in encrypted form and to make it available to agents and workflows that you explicitly permit. Specifically:
- Workflows: Gazebo makes API calls to a service only after you review and explicitly approve the generated execution plan.
- Agent tokens: When you create an agent and grant it access to one or more services, the agent can retrieve those credentials via the MCP endpoint or API. You control which services each agent can access. You can revoke access at any time.
You are solely responsible for ensuring you have the right to grant this access and that the agents and workflow plans you authorise are correct. All credential accesses are recorded in your audit log.
